So, we were camping and when we woke up there were 2 nice looking dogs laying beside my car, thin as a rail and shaking from the cold. We picked them up and called the owner. He lives in the national forest and knows the area like the back of his hand. He told me about this place and one other I went. This is at the end of Earls Ford Road, which you get to by turning right off of hwy 28 onto Warwoman Rd, then Left onto Earls Ford Rd. Its about 100 ft. across and has a depth ranging from 3 in. to about 27 in. On the other side is one of the most beautiful campsites I've ever seen. I'll definantly be making a return trip.
